Output bb17cdaa15100aa0cbfc72b4c52c6ee1a74ba28c367a80377ee98e4a169cde90:1

value
587593
script pubkey
OP_0 OP_PUSHBYTES_20 3689d2405a042da5ce5741002740fb2f1b4a1d4d
address
bc1qx6yaysz6qsk6tnjhgyqzws8m9ud5582d52ag9g
transaction
bb17cdaa15100aa0cbfc72b4c52c6ee1a74ba28c367a80377ee98e4a169cde90